It has been a challenging year for athletes and coaches.  The concern is that the mental health consequences of isolation, disconnection, worry and fear will have long lasting effects.  Although engagement in a sporting activity is protective to mental health, the data are clear that mental ill-health does not discriminate - athletes are equally at risk.  

The truth is that athletes can be performing at a high level and be struggling with their mental health at the same time. Athletic culture promotes being tough and persevering through immense hardship. This enhances the stigma around asking for help or discussing mental challenges.  This strategy of suppressing emotion can work for some, but is often unsustainable over time.  As members of the climbing community, we have the power to choose to be kinder to ourselves and embrace our hardships as well as our successes!  Let’s do it together!
